  • Patent number: 10755852
    Abstract: A winding apparatus includes a first rotation body, and a wire position support, inserted in an insertion hole outside a center axis of the first rotation body, and including first and second wire route holes in which first and second wires are inserted, respectively. The winding apparatus further includes a second rotation body having a center axis and separated from the first rotation body, a shaft body outside the center axis, a synchronous rotation component coupling the wire position support and the shaft body while unrotatably fixed to the wire position support, a winding driver that synchronously rotates the first and second rotation bodies, and inner bearings disposed between the wire position support in the insertion hole and the first rotation body, in which the wire position support is journaled with respect to the first rotation body. Thus, the wire position support revolves orbitally about a core without rotating.

  • Publication number: 20130287990
    Abstract: An elastic composite twisted yarn includes a covered elastic yarn, having a core yarn formed of an elastic yarn and a sheath yarn formed of a thermoplastic multi filament, and first and second low stretch yarns formed of a thermoplastic multi-filament yarn or a spun yarn. The covered elastic yarn is drawn at a predetermined draw ratio to be inserted into the first low stretch yarn in a combined yarn state. The yarn in the combined yarn state and the second low stretch yarn are combined and twisted to obtain an elastic composite twisted yarn. A plurality of heteromorphic micro-loops formed of a constituent single fiber of the sheath yarn, which appears during the relaxation by a contractile force of the covered elastic yarn, protruding from the core yarn to a diameter direction, is usually incorporated into a constituent single fiber of the first low stretch yarn and thermally set.

  • Patent number: 6775970
    Abstract: A process and apparatus are disclosed for making a hybrid cord which may be used. The process combines and twists at least three yarns together where one of the yarns is different. The different yarn maybe of a different size (denier), or made from a different polymer, or both. The hybrid cord may be used in tires, hoses, v-belts, and conveyor belts, for example. The apparatus is a modified direct cabler machine in which at least two yarns from a creel are combined and twisted about a third yarn issuing from a spindle pot. It is contemplated that the different yarn is preferably one of the yarns on the creel. Various tensioners are employed to tightly wrap or twist the yarns together (generally at a rate of from about 5-12 turns per linear inch of the yarn issuing from the spindle pot), and to wind the cord on a bobbin.

  • Patent number: 6513314
    Abstract: The invention includes a first bobbin that supplies a first yarn, a second bobbin that supplies a second yarn, and a third bobbin that supplies a third yarn. Additionally, the invention includes a guide that guides the first and second yarns so that they are substantially parallel to each other, and a combining device the combines and twists the parallel disposed first and second yarns with the third yarn. The invention enables the manufacture of a two-ply cord having a filler yarn therein, in a single step, and also allows more cord to be manufactured within a specified time period.

  • Patent number: 6434922
    Abstract: A method and a device for facilitating the sliding, along a track, of an element having a predominant axial dimension subjected to an intense force pressing it against the track, particularly for facilitating the sliding of a wire subjected to stranding in stranding machines. The method consists in interposing between the element and the track a pressurized fluid which contrasts the force that presses the element against the track. In this way, the sliding friction of the element on the track is reduced and it is possible to reduce the force to be applied to the element in order to achieve its advancement along the track.
